Delta Queens’ Enoma Gift sets sights on NWFL Premiership Super Six

Enoma Gift,

Delta Queens’ star player, Enoma Gift, has set her sights on helping her team secure a spot in the NWFL Premiership Super Six.

Ahead of their home game against Adamawa Queens, Gift expressed confidence in her team’s abilities, stating that their target is still very much achievable.

“We are currently fifth in Group B with 11 points from 10 games, but we are not giving up,” Gift said in an interview with NAIRA SPORTS.

She continued, “Our target is to qualify for the Super Six, and it’s still very much possible.”

Delta Queens will face Adamawa Queens in their next match, and Gift’s comments suggest that the team is ready to put up a strong fight. With their sights set on the Super Six, Delta Queens will need to perform well in their remaining matches to achieve their goal.

The team’s current position in Group B may not be ideal, but Gift’s statement shows that they are not giving up. Instead, they are focused on working towards their target and making a strong comeback in the league.
